Transaction 124526326fa7d6485e9561cc4e337baf54ff9349bc05ad174d2c1f22cfb8783d
1 Input
1 Output
-
124526326fa7d6485e9561cc4e337baf54ff9349bc05ad174d2c1f22cfb8783d:0
- value
- 18726393
- script pubkey
- OP_0 OP_PUSHBYTES_20 93af09d4d03ec64e740ae5e3ff9091dcc29d175f
- address
- bc1qjwhsn4xs8mryuaq2uh3llyy3mnpf696lvjnkgz